Microsoft disclosed record annual revenue growth of 18% for its fiscal year, attributing the increase to strong demand for AI-related services and products. The company also revealed plans to reduce its workforce by approximately 14% of its 2023 headcount over the past two years, though this does not represent a net reduction of 14%. The layoffs follow previous workforce reductions, including 15,000 cuts in 2025 and an additional 4,800 in July 2026.
The company highlighted a strategic shift in its AI architecture, moving away from dependence on a single model family toward a system that separates harness, context, memory, and action spaces. This approach aims to improve resilience, cost efficiency, and business continuity by allowing models to be interchangeable within a stable operational framework. Microsoft emphasized the importance of governance integrity, noting that accountability and authority must remain consistent even as models are substituted.
Microsoft’s AI leadership is increasingly focused on building systems that integrate context, memory, and agency into everyday workflows rather than relying solely on advanced models. The company reported that Copilot usage among enterprise customers grew by 75% quarter-over-quarter, reflecting broader adoption of AI tools that enhance productivity and decision-making across business functions.
During the earnings call, Microsoft CEO Satya Nadella discussed the reinvention of Microsoft Dynamics 365 for an agent-first world, exposing over 650,000 MCP actions across sales, finance, supply chain, HR, and customer service. The shift includes transitioning from a per-seat licensing model to a combined seats-plus-consumption model, enabling agents to access business context and take actions aligned with existing data models, rules, and security protocols.
